Best Paper Award

2017-09-19 1 min read

The workshop paper “Learning CNN-based Features for Retrieval of Food Image” by_ Gianluigi Ciocca, Paolo Napoletano, and Raimondo Schettini_ from University of Milan-Bicocca received the MADiMa2017 Best Paper Award.

The best paper was selected based on the votes of the workshop’s participants. After the last oral session, all present participants were given a sheet to vote for the best paper. Each voter was allowed to vote for up to three (3) papers. Voters were not allowed to vote for papers they are co-authoring (voter’s name was also provided on the sheet to ensure there were no conflicts of interest) The best paper award selection process was described at the workshop’s opening and the results were presented at the workshop’s closing.
